Adelaide University researchers have made a significant breakthrough by demonstrating that pairing sniffer dogs with an air-sampling device can significantly enhance the detection of illegally trafficked wildlife hidden within shipping containers. This innovative approach combines the natural olfactory prowess of dogs with a simple yet effective sampling tool, potentially revolutionizing efforts to combat wildlife trafficking. The study highlights how the air-sampling device collects scents from inside shipping containers, which are then analyzed by sniffer dogs trained to detect specific wildlife odors. This method addresses a major challenge faced by customs officials: traditional manual inspections often fail to uncover hidden contraband due to time constraints and limited effectiveness. By automating scent collection, the device allows for more efficient and accurate detection, reducing reliance on labor-intensive methods.
